Lottery and gaming organizations face unique challenges to grow their market share and manage their business risk. Online gambling services can be profitable but subject to fraudulent credit application or abuse of offers and promotions. Recent cases in North America have highlighted that winning tickets may be disproportionately biased towards particular service outlets. Increasing market share means addressing high rates of churn in loyalty programs and effectively targeting consumers for product or channel cross-sell.
With the availability of rich data these challenges lend themselves very well to predictive analytics solutions based on traditional data mining tools and techniques. In this presentation, data mining industry expert and author Dr. Mamdouh Refaat will review key areas of prevalent technology with business examples of highly successful solutions that highlight the ability to access actionable intelligence from customer data at low costs.
